MARGATE
CENTENARY CHOIR FESTIVAL 2010

29 May 2010

Margate Community Hall

09h00 – 16h00

 

“The curious beauty of African music is that it uplifts even if it tells a sad tale. You may be poor, you may only have a ramshackle house, you may have lost your job, but that song gives you hope.”

Nelson Mandela

 Church choirs, Youth choirs, School choirs and Community choirs offer a sense of community to some of the most destitute and impoverished people in our society. The coming together and singing gives renewed hope and offers people a sense of belonging. Margate and the surrounding areas have a wealth of untapped talent in our region. This Centenary year we plan to showcase these talents and share in the rich experiences of these diverse and talented groups.

 The Applicants

                The competition is open to choirs from within the Ugu South Coast Region.

                The competition is open for amateurs and professionals.

                A choir must consist of a minimum of 12 voices.

A choir must have been established at least 6 months prior to the competition and must be able to evidence that.

                Each performer must produce an original valid ID document.

 Pieces to be performed

                Each choir must be prepared to sing 3 songs not exceeding a total of 10 minutes. The choir may sing accompanied or unaccompanied. Accompaniment may be provided by a piano or other instrument/s. A Piano will be provided at the competition.

 Judging

Choirs will be judged on the balance of their programme. Choral work must meet with a high standard of intonation, diction, tone quality, phrasing and interpretation. Soloist with a choir is allowed. Judging will be done in this order of priority, Musicianship, Technique, Programme Choice and Presentation and Choreography.
